Output 77f4bb4359c22de177740428fa785593ffa6d31e8733f573c3f7cbde03c5dd7f:1

value
30272075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44b6a8214117fc5b74ba3390b82d010d7d11f22f OP_EQUALVERIFY OP_CHECKSIG
address
17GKmFzUpSXZzzFuxmeYviog47iGtuCtkE
transaction
77f4bb4359c22de177740428fa785593ffa6d31e8733f573c3f7cbde03c5dd7f
confirmations
599072
spent
true